- GEN8 and GEN9 support is built and tested separately
- don't use dpkg in Arch builds
- optimize build times
Change-Id: I0be818d2afa9a86281a4e4030e8ecd10cd861efe
Signed-off-by: Jacek Danecki <jacek.danecki@intel.com>
- images from subbuffer with non-zero offset relative to
parent buffer didn't have correct Surface Address offset
Change-Id: I6ae2b87f8c9d19e40ec14a29b5eadc7401db18ad
IGC binaries are used from specific Neo release.
IGC sources are synchronized with binary release.
Change-Id: If75aebc68aa0ced1b5c7493747eedc3e16842252
use deviceId from first entry in deviceDescriptorTable as default deviceId
correct using simplified mocs table
Change-Id: I3a6e7cd599912380d48937767f201b44ee98e391
- when flag is enabled driver will not go with zero copy path for
CL_MEM_USE_HOST_PTR flag
- flag doesn't work in shared context where we must accept zero copy
storage.
Change-Id: Idda94f296dd12e7e3ccb15f2224808287551ac97
The structure of https://github.com/KhronosGroup/OpenCL-Headers.git has
changed recently and we have to adjust to new layout.
New flow is:
1. try old layout with opencl21 folder in repo, continue compilation
if successful
2. try with new layout
Change-Id: Ia8c3eb76655aeef70512e9a03d74c72ba776fd4f
Signed-off-by: Artur Harasimiuk <artur.harasimiuk@intel.com>
- Create Wddm20 interface by default for runtime and ULTs
- Add Windows dll test for Wddm creation
Change-Id: Id0a1b86e68112c31078b6965c647a5218790150f
when SLD is active:
- make Sip Kernel Resident
- program GPGPU_CSR_BASE_ADDRESS
- Disable Preemption
- adjust getDebuggerOption input param,
value passed has to be at least 2 bytes in size
change unit test behaviour accordingly
Change-Id: I4ec87d0e8dfcf02437fdeeffc5363314eea5dd07
- Change dirty state helpers to work on IndirectHeaps.
- Instead of comparing size in bytes and cpu pointers, compare gpu base
address and size of the heap in pages
- That allows to not have dirty flag for heaps that are coming from 4GB
allocator.
Change-Id: I0ff81e3c0945b32e4f872a100cd10b332b27ed24
- notifySourceCode, notifyKernelDebugData, notifyDeviceDestruction
- added processDebugData method in Program
- change options when SLD is active
- add space at the beginning of extension list options
Change-Id: Iac1e52f849544dbfda62407e112cde83fa94e3ad
- For every command buffer that we submit, pass it to gem close worker.
- Gem close worker will do asynchronous cleanup if this resource is meant to
be destroyed.
- if the resource is not meant to be destroyed we will call IOCTL wait for
this batch buffer.
- This will result in bumping up GPU clocks and better performance.
Change-Id: If9f181e411d7748573f31682e875a97c5355abe5
- Only Wddm object owns Gdi
- Dont pass Gdi object to constructor
- Move Wddm related files to new directory
Change-Id: Iadd26634c7692db760d7d3367211c32d2c2c8121